The Benefits Of PTFE Bearings For Industrial Applications

PTFE bearings are a type of self-lubricating bearing that is commonly used in various industrial applications PTFE, which stands for polytetrafluoroethylene, is a synthetic material known for its low friction properties and high resistance to chemicals, temperature, and wear These properties make PTFE bearings an ideal choice for applications where traditional bearings may not be suitable.

One of the main benefits of PTFE bearings is their self-lubricating property This means that they do not require additional lubrication to operate efficiently, reducing maintenance costs and downtime The low friction coefficient of PTFE also means that these bearings operate smoothly and quietly, making them suitable for applications where noise levels need to be kept to a minimum.

Another advantage of PTFE bearings is their high resistance to chemicals PTFE is a chemically inert material, meaning that it will not react with most chemicals, solvents, or acids This makes PTFE bearings ideal for applications where exposure to harsh chemicals is a concern, such as in the chemical processing industry or the food and beverage industry.

PTFE bearings also have a high resistance to temperature, with the ability to withstand both high and low temperatures without losing their performance characteristics This makes PTFE bearings suitable for applications where temperature fluctuations are common, such as in automotive, aerospace, and industrial machinery.

In addition to their self-lubricating property, chemical resistance, and temperature resistance, PTFE bearings also exhibit high wear resistance ptfe bearing. The low friction coefficient of PTFE means that these bearings have a longer lifespan compared to traditional bearings, reducing the frequency of replacement and lowering overall maintenance costs.

PTFE bearings are available in various shapes and configurations, including cylindrical, flanged, and thrust bearings, making them suitable for a wide range of applications They can also be custom-made to meet specific requirements, providing a tailored solution for unique industrial applications.

One common application of PTFE bearings is in pumps and compressors, where they are used to reduce friction and wear, resulting in improved efficiency and extended equipment lifespan PTFE bearings are also used in automotive components, such as suspension systems and steering columns, where their self-lubricating property helps to reduce maintenance requirements and improve performance.

In the food and beverage industry, PTFE bearings are used in conveyor systems, packaging machinery, and processing equipment, where their high resistance to chemicals and temperature make them an ideal choice for handling food products safely and efficiently PTFE bearings are also used in the pharmaceutical industry, where cleanliness and sterility are critical, as PTFE is non-reactive and easy to clean.
